Varon Vehicles develops Air Mobility Infrastructure
Founding Year: 2016
Location: Cambridge, US
Partner for Airspace Integration, Advanced Air Mobility
US-based startup Varon Vehicles develops air mobility and aviation technologies. The startup’s proprietary Infrastructure Networks integrate urban air transport. Varon vehicle’s Vertiports are low-altitude lanes through which the aircraft will fly. The startup has designed Airspace Integration Architecture, virtual spaces that organize traffic orchestration mechanisms and permanently reserve airspace. The startup’s concept of Urban Geodesics, the shortest path between no-flying zones in urban air routes, advances urban air mobility.
Advanced Air Mobility provides Personal Air Mobility
Founding Year: 2019
Location: Barcelona, Spain
Reach out for Personal Air Commuting
Spanish startup Advanced Air Mobility offers a personal air mobility solution. The startup’s personal air commuting aircraft offers a payload capacity of up to 200 kg. Advanced Air Mobility provides a Plug’nFly concept and an electric propulsion system-based aircraft. The startup also features an automatic navigation system, provides a speed of 25-300 km/hr, and covers about 300-500 kilometer range. Further, the startup’s electric propulsion system makes it an environmentally friendly and sustainable air transport solution.
Skydrive builds a Flying Car
Founding Year: 2018
Location: Tokyo, Japan
Partner for Drone-based Logistics
Japanese startup Skydrive designs and develops SD-XX, a battery-powered flying car. The startup’s flying car reduces noise pollution and flies at a lower altitude – at 500 meters. The SD-XX takes off and lands vertically and features a compact cabin for two passengers. The startup’s proprietary aircraft is a lightweight, zero-emission model which enables door-to-door air travel. Skydrive’s SD-XX is compact and lands in parking lots and buildings with helipads. The startup’s Skylift is an automated cargo drone, that aids in heavy material transport. The drone allows cargo transport of up to 30 kg per flight and up to 700 kg per day.
Unisphere enables Automated Unmanned Aviation
Founding Year: 2017
Location: Konstanz, Germany
Reach out for Smart Flight Management
German startup Unisphere offers smart flight management software. The startup provides a holistic operational, forecasting, and management platform for electric vertical take-off and landing (eVTOL) aircraft. The Unisphere Flight Management Platform has integrated Smart 4D trajectory software that enables automated flight planning, flight monitoring, and post-flight analytics. Unisphere’s software automates real-time deviation monitoring, reduces aircraft load, and manages flight schedules and routes. The documentation of relevant information post-flight is done automatically and secured in blockchain to improve performance analytics and business decisions.
Urban-Air Port advances Urban Air Mobility
Founding Year: 2019
Location: London, UK
Partner for Zero-Emission Air Mobility
UK-based startup Urban-Air Port develops ground service for urban air mobility. The startup provides an off-grid, electric, and carbon-neutral micro airport Infrastructure-as-a-Service (MAIaaS). The MAIaaS is reusable, flat packed, and also incorporates renewables for its design. Urban-Air Port’s RESILIENCE ONE features an in-house Air Traffic Control (ATC) suite as well as a 200-meter command and control center. It provides support for disaster relief operations, airside-mobile clinic, air evacuation hubs, forest fires, oil spills, and defense applications.
